The Rodeo Fleet, a union of independent deep space freight crews, is responsible for the safe transport and processing of asteroids in a sol system where resource extraction on Earth is impossible. The Chavez is their first KM intended for combat- It's smaller than a Gupp, but extremely durable.

The Art of Angel’s Egg reprint (released this month to coincide with the 4k restoration) is a great way to revisit a long out of print book. For fans of Mamoru Oshii and Yoshitaka Amano it’s worth picking up though like the name suggests it’s really just artwork, very little text.

Today is the anniversary of the passing of Hideo Azuma. Disappearance Diary is a singular work and it's a shame there aren't more Lemon People alum available in English.
